Real-Time Hazard Detection & Forecasting

Hugues Brenot from the Royal Belgian Institute for Space Aeronomy (BIRA-IASB) presented our work on the integration of the COBRA algorithm with the KAIROS AI system.

  • The Innovation: By exploiting the full infrared spectral capabilities of geostationary sensors, COBRA improves the identification of volcanic SO₂, desert dust, and ice crystals.

  • The Impact: These high-frequency observations feed directly into the KAIROS AI system, providing near-global, data-driven predictions of plume evolution to support real-time aviation safety decisions.
